How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Jessup?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Jessup Studio Apartments | $1,891 | $1,709 | $2,279 |
| Jessup 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,062 | $1,199 | $4,723 |
| Jessup 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,545 | $1,425 | $7,715 |
| Jessup 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,143 | $1,795 | $5,603 |
| Jessup 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,424 | $2,682 | $6,611 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Jessup
How much are Studio apartments in Jessup?
There are currently 4 Studio Apartments in Jessup with rent ranges from $1,709 to $2,279 with an average price of $1,891.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Jessup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Jessup ranges from $1,199 to $4,723 with an average monthly rent of $2,062.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Jessup c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Jessup range from $1,425 to $7,715.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,545.
How expensive are Jessup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Jessup on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,795 to $5,603 - averaging $3,143 for the location.
